Francesco Braschi entered in Eurocup-3 with Campos

Francesco Braschi will occupy Campos Racing's second seat in Eurocup-3. ©Campos Racing

The third team entered in the brand new Eurocup-3 championship, Campos Racing was also the first to draw by announcing the first name of its crew, a few weeks ago. And alongside Tasanapol Inthraphuvasak, the team will field the Italian Francesco Braschi. The pilot debuted in car three years ago, in the transalpine F4 championship where he will remain for two seasons. At the same time, Braschi is entering the grids of the Spanish, German and Emirati categories of the discipline. His 2022 campaign was punctuated by his participations in Regional Formulas Europe and Asia, where he finished in 26th and 22nd positions respectively. After starting his year in FRMEC under the colors of R-ace GP, he will join the Eurocup-3 from its inaugural round at Spa-Francorchamps (Belgium), next May.

“It will be a big challenge for everyone, recalls Adrián Campos, director of the Spanish team, because it's a new championship with an equally new car, but we are fully confident that we will be able to fight for the best positions from the start. We are a strong team, and Francesco is undoubtedly a key element in accomplishing this goal. We are working tirelessly in our facilities to become the benchmark in this new category. »

The championship will take place on different tracks in Europe, notably in Spain, Italy and Austria. Only the two Campos drivers have been announced for the moment, and two competing teams from the Valencia structure: MP Motorsport and the team of driver Alex Palou, with the eponymous name Palou Motorsport.
